These are great African doctors and scientists who made important discoveries and improvements to healthcare on our continent. Lambo revolutionized mental health treatment by showing that African traditional healers and modern medicine could work together effectively. Omololu Ogunlesi pioneered orthopaedic surgery in Nigeria, treating thousands of patients with bone and joint problems. Oluwole Odeku made remarkable contributions to neurosurgery, training many Nigerian doctors in brain surgery techniques. Konotey-Ahulu's work in genetics helped us understand sickle cell disease better across Africa. These pioneers didn't just copy Western medicine—they adapted it to suit African needs and cultures, making healthcare more accessible to ordinary Nigerians. Their dedication showed that Africans could lead in medical science. Adeniyi-Jones contributed significantly to public health, improving disease prevention across West Africa.
